I'll describe what I did in each image to make the process of removing everything from the shipping container and getting it ready to go as simple as possible. Hope it's useful!1. A photo of the packaging after delivery. Ensure that it is facing up as indicated. It will be much harder to unpack everything if you try to do so with the box on its side.2. I applied the following three tools. A box cutter, in (A). I cut the tape first and went around on all four sides. (B) A screwdriver with slots. (C) Pliers in a set3. A photo of the staples that I once again removed from all four sides before making an attempt to remove the top cover. I pry them off with the screwdriver until I can grab them with the pliers and pull them out the rest of the way. Even though there are only 10–12 staples altogether, it can be difficult to break the cardboard apart because they are firmly stapled in.4. After removing the top cover, take a picture. The cover will easily come off if all the staples are taken out and the tape is cut.5. Box cutters or scissors are required to cut the nylon strapping.6. Four hardwood planks are covered in cardboard and fastened to the inside of the top cover to add additional protection. This prevents any of the product from shifting while being transported. The top of the box did sustain some damage, but the additional layer of protection did a terrific job overall.7. Additionally, there are 4 rubber bumpers at each corner.8. The last thing you need to take apart is the table's two halves. Again, it is advised that two people transport it to its ultimate location for assembly due to its mass and weight.9. Supporting documents.ADVANCED NOTE: Make sure the table is as level as you can get it, and lock all eight wheels into position by pulling the lever on each one. This is what I bought to put on top of my air hockey table. With a few minor adjustments, this setup, which was simple to do, is currently serving us well. The top of the air hockey table had various score keeping devices attached, which prevented the table from sitting level. The top of the air hockey table now sits level thanks to some rubber spacers/feet that I purchased and fastened into place. However, that issue was with my air hockey table, not this product, so I do not hold that against it.Only two minor issues do I have with this top. One of the internet posts arrived first utterly broken. I learn that this happens frequently from reading other reviews. After getting in touch with Joola, I received a replacement net set in my mailbox a few days later. Very simple, and excellent service. Just be ready for that scenario. The second is that the two sides of the table are very slightly out of alignment due to the seam that runs down its center length, where the hinges are located on the bottom. Because it is so small, you can't even tell by looking at it, but you can feel it if you run your palm along it. Every now and then, the ball will strike it precisely, changing the trajectory's direction. Our new house rule states that we must simply chuckle, call "SEAM!" and replay the shot when this occurs since it makes us giggle. A very little inconvenience, but be aware of it nonetheless. If you're playing competitive championship-level table tennis, you're not looking at this anyhow.Overall, I'm delighted I bought it and we are having a great time with it!
